#A07DA6 Color
#A07DA6 is rgb(160, 125, 166) in RGB, hsl(291, 19%, 57%) in HSL, and about cmyk(4%, 25%, 0%, 35%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Opera Mauve (#B784A7),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.85.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#A07DA6 Channel Values
How #A07DA6 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 160 · G 125 · B 166 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 291° · S 19% · L 57%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 291° · S 25% · V 65%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 4% · M 25% · Y 0% · K 35%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.51:1 vs white · 5.98: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#A07DA6 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#A07DA6 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#A07DA6?
#A07DA6 is a mid-tone pink — rgb(160, 125, 166) in RGB and hsl(291, 19%, 57%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Opera Mauve (#B784A7),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.85.
What is the RGB value of #A07DA6?
#A07DA6 is rgb(160, 125, 166) — red 160, green 125, and blue 166 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#A07DA6?
#A07DA6 converts to approximately cmyk(4%, 25%, 0%, 35%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#A07DA6 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#A07DA6 scores 3.51:1 against white and 5.98: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#A07DA6 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#A07DA6 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is plum (#DDA0DD) at a CIE76 distance of 20.53, which is visibly different.
